A new NEJM analysis provides clinicians with three essential takeaways regarding race-based medication dosing that have direct implications for patient care. First, racial categories poorly reflect the actual biological differences in drug metabolism that drive pharmacokinetic variation. Second, genetic testing and biomarker analysis offer significantly more precise alternatives for guiding treatment decisions. Third, continued reliance on racial categories in dosing protocols may inadvertently perpetuate health disparities rather than advance equitable care.

For practicing physicians, these findings suggest an opportunity to enhance clinical practice by transitioning toward precision medicine approaches. Rather than applying categorical assumptions, clinicians can now access pharmacogenetic testing that identifies individual drug-metabolizing capacity, enabling truly personalized dosing strategies.

This paradigm shift requires updating clinical guidelines, provider education, and healthcare infrastructure to support accessible genetic testing. The potential benefit—more effective treatment with reduced adverse outcomes—justifies the transition to evidence-based, individualized dosing approaches.
